Output 706254161265e805bd998177a21038b1e02f2619cff08843a2fd03de946e5e45:1

value
343051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dd406ebf337bb2ed95d51ce5e506ed0a1711fe2 OP_EQUAL
address
32x8hw9b5qk21nUtaqgTodqEBJVNFEwhnk
transaction
706254161265e805bd998177a21038b1e02f2619cff08843a2fd03de946e5e45